The United States boasts a highly developed crocodile farming industry due to its significant economic value. Among the numerous large farms, the St. Augustine Alligator Farm in Florida stands out as the largest, spanning 20 acres and housing over 2,000 alligators, including one measuring 15 feet in length. Crocodiles, being semi-aquatic reptiles, require both water and land for activities like basking and resting. At St. Augustine, barns mimic the American alligator's natural habitat with spacious enclosures featuring trees, swamps, and lakes. Each cage provides ample room, with a water surface area of up to 33 square feet and sunbathing areas spanning 33 square feet, allowing crocodiles to move freely and enjoy their surroundings.


Crocodiles usually mate in spring or early summer when the water warms. Female crocodiles lay 20 to 60 eggs, but large ones can lay up to 100, in deep nests on river or lake banks. Workers collect the eggs for incubation, maintaining temperatures between 30°C to 32°C and humidity at 90% to 100%, with hatching occurring after 65 to 80 days. Baby crocodiles are independent from birth, able to feed themselves with their sharp teeth and powerful claws. They have excellent eyesight and hearing, and can move quickly on land and in water. When selecting crocodile breeds, workers choose healthy animals that swim well, have no deformities, and are of uniform size. They prepare clean barns and release the crocodiles into lakes using plastic containers, introducing the new water source at the same time. The release occurs in the early morning or late afternoon to avoid temperature stress.


Crocodiles are carnivores that primarily eat vertebrates like fish, poultry, and amphibians, along with synthetic bran pellets. Breeders adjust feeding frequency and amounts based on the crocodile's age, with baby crocodiles fed daily and adults 2-3 times per week. The food provided is enough for a 30-minute feeding session. It is poured directly on the ground for the crocodiles to consume themselves.


Each farm and harvesting purpose is different, so the time to harvest crocodiles varies. Typically, after 3-5 years, a crocodile reaches 5-8 feet in length and weighs 44-132 pounds. Farm workers use electrical equipment to stun the crocodile before transport, securing their jaws with duct tape and tying their legs, then wrapping them in plastic bags. Crocodiles are knocked unconscious with electricity before processing. A worker makes a small cut in the crocodile's foot and inflates the skin with air to ease separation. Using a small knife, incisions are made between the legs and along the back. The skin is removed from the back, tail, legs, abdomen, and neck using a 45-degree knife angle. The skin is then washed and cleaned before soaking, tanning, dyeing, and being sent to leather factories. Crocodile meat is divided, with tenderloin being the most popular. Sika Park Farm, spanning over 100 hectares in Rangipo, houses over 1,500 Sika deer for antler, meat, and dairy production. Annually, it yields over 220 pounds of deer antlers and 220,000 pounds of deer meat. The barn area is spacious, providing ample room for deer to live and exercise comfortably. Scientifically designed, the barn ensures optimal ventilation, roofing for weather protection, and an efficient drainage system. Segmented areas within the barn cater to breeding, rearing young, fattening, and disease isolation. Construction materials such as steel, steel mesh, and concrete are chosen for their safety, durability, and ease of cleaning, maintaining high standards of hygiene and welfare.


Deer breed seasonally, typically in the fall. A female's estrous cycle lasts about 20 days, and gestation is around 8 months. They usually give birth to one or two fawns, which the mother licks clean. Fawns drink mother's milk for about 4 months before weaning. They grow quickly, reaching 60-70 pounds in a few months. Breeding deer are selected for their balance, health, and alertness, with smooth, shiny skin, bright eyes, a wet nose, and a pink, infection-free mouth. Male deer should have balanced, well-developed horns, and all deer should have a slim belly, strong limbs, and regular hooves.


Newborn deer are fed milk initially, then fresh grass, hay, and nuts from 3-5 weeks old for fiber. They are fed twice daily, morning and evening, with food intake varying by age. Baby deer need more food than adults, with weaned deer requiring 2.2-4.4 pounds of fresh food per day and adult deer needing 6.6-13 pounds daily, depending on sex. Farmers allocate food to ensure even growth and provide constant water. To maintain health, a veterinarian regularly examines and vaccinates the deer.


Deer are harvested for antlers at 4-6 months old. Workers prepare tools like a sterilized sharp knife, pliers, rope, salt water, antiseptic, and cotton wool. They clean the tools with saline and disinfect them with alcohol, and the area is sanitized to prevent bacterial contamination. An anesthetic is injected into the deer to calm it, and its legs are tied to keep it still. The deer is blindfolded during the process to prevent panic and fear.

Deer will be harvested for meat when they are 18 - 26 months old. Deer meat harvesting can take place after the 2nd or 3rd antler harvest. They will be transported by specialized trucks, with many ventilation compartments, ensuring air and temperature throughout the journey. The person in charge needs to monitor the deer herd carefully, recording all necessary information to ensure a safe trip and a sufficient number of deer to reach the processing plant.

After harvesting deer antlers, the deer's hair is shaved off carefully with a sharp razor to avoid skin tearing. A knife is used to cut along the spine from neck to tail, and the skin is delicately separated from the body. Excess fat inside the skin is removed with a knife, and then the skin is rinsed with cold water to eliminate dirt and blood. The skin is soaked in cold water for 24 hours to soften it before being soaked in salt. A specialized solution is applied to bleach the skin, followed by another solution to reinforce it for increased durability and elasticity. Deer skin is commonly used to craft leather items such as shoes, gloves, and bags.


The deer is hung on the floor and a torch is used to remove the remaining hair. Open the deer's abdomen from chest to anus. Remove all internal organs from the deer's stomach. Rinse the abdominal cavity with cold water. The worker will divide the meat into large parts. The tenderloin, thigh meat and bones are separated. The worker will remove excess fat and tendons sticking to the meat. The entire process needs to be done quickly, avoid shredding the meat, and ensure deer meat quality.
